I would guess that the comments in the code fragments are wrong.

The number of cycles required between a MULT, MULTU, DIV or DIVU operation
and a subsequent MFHI or MFLO operation in order that no interlock
occurs is:

		MULT	MULTU	DIV	DIVU
R2000/R3000	 12	 12	35	35
R6000		 17	 18	38	37
